使用java實(shí)現(xiàn)word轉(zhuǎn)pdf,親測(cè)有效,完美保
Java可以通過使用 POI庫(kù)實(shí)現(xiàn)將Word文檔轉(zhuǎn)換為PDF格式。 POI提供了對(duì)微軟文件的支持,包括讀取和寫入Word文檔。為了將Word文檔轉(zhuǎn)換為PDF格式,我們需要使用 POI中的類來讀取Word文檔,并使用庫(kù)創(chuàng)建PDF文檔。首先,我們需要在項(xiàng)目中引入 POI和的依賴。然后,我們可以使用以下代碼將Word文檔轉(zhuǎn)換為PDF格式:```try {//讀取Word文檔 = new (new (".docx"));//創(chuàng)建PDF文檔 = new (new (".pdf"));//創(chuàng)建PDF頁面.();//將Word文檔內(nèi)容寫入PDF頁面 = new (.(1)); font = .(.); = new (, , new (36, 750, 523, 760));for ( para : .()) {.(font).(para.().("\n", " "));.add(new (""));}.();//關(guān)閉PDF文檔.();} ( e) {e.();}```以上代碼讀取名為“.docx”的Word文檔,并創(chuàng)建名為“.pdf”的PDF文件。
使用.()方法創(chuàng)建PDF頁面,使用將Word文檔內(nèi)容寫入PDF頁面。在這個(gè)例子中,我們使用了默認(rèn)字體和默認(rèn)文本顏色。如果您需要使用不同的字體、顏色或其他樣式,請(qǐng)使用相關(guān)的類和方法。這是一個(gè)基本的Word轉(zhuǎn)PDF的例子,如果您需要更多高級(jí)的功能,可以通過使用或其他的PDF生成庫(kù)來實(shí)現(xiàn)。